- Title:
- Research papers of Castalia Leveson-Gower, Countess Granville
- Scope & Content:
-
Castalia Leveson-Gower’s research notes, correspondence on translation and other research questions, and drafts of editorial text in preparation for publication of her book, Lord Granville Leveson Gower: Private Correspondence (1916). Chiefly manuscript.
Contents:
- Notes extracted from letters of Lady Stafford, Lady Sutherland and Lord Gower, relating to visit to Paris, June – August 1790. With a note for Mr Murray.
- ‘Epitaph for herself by Georgiana Duchess of Devonshire’. Transcript in the hand of Castalia Leveson-Gower. Note at the end of epitaph: ‘Lines written by Georgiana Duchess of Devonshire on the back of a note from the Duke of Devonshire apparently in 1774’.
- Signed note by Castalia Leveson-Gower on headed paper stating ‘Enclosed contains Birth certificate & Baptism of Harriet Emma Arundel Stewart 1800 & 1801 just as I found it in the satin pochette’. Refers also to an oval snuff box with a miniature of two children’s heads referred to by Lady Bessborough in her letters. None of these items were present when the collection was acquired by the British Library.
- Letters and notes on people and places, and questions of translation or quotation, including correspondence with the Countess’s son, Granville George Leveson-Gower, 3rd Earl Granville, in Paris, Amy Dingle, and Harold Russell.
- Lists of nicknames used by Lady Bessborough, Lord Granville and their circle.
- Lists of incomplete letters, headed ‘Want beginning’ and ‘Unfinished’.
- Research notes on scraps of paper, including lists of Russian names, notes on French aristocratic emigrés during the Revolution.
- Draft introduction (incomplete) and chapter introductions.
- Picture research: lists of possible illustrations for the book, including ‘Suggestions for Illustrations’.
